I have a 12 foot aluminum boat. With 2 250 pound guys in it and no gear I get about 6 mph. Does that sound right? 1967 mercury 9.8

most 12' aluminum boats have a 350-400 pound capacity weight limit. 500# of people, 67# of motor and a minimum of 30# of fuel and your significantly over the weight limit of the boat.

I have a 12' aluminum boat with s 67 9.8 mercury on it!!
i weigh 175 , a three gallon can and I get 21mph on my speed app.
with me and my wife at approximately 350 lbs total it will go 16.
unless your boat is much heavier construction I think you should do better than 6??
